Diagnostic Procedure

  1. Did you perform the diagnostic system check? If so, go to next step. If not, see DIAGNOSTIC SYSTEM CHECK  under SELF-DIAGNOSTIC SYSTEM.
  2. Check transmission fluid level. Fill if necessary. See appropriate AUTOMATIC article in TRANSMISSION SERVICING. Go to next step.
  3. Connect scan tool to DLC. Turn ignition on, engine off. Using scan tool, record freeze frame and failure records for reference, and then clear DTCs. Test drive vehicle in 4th gear with TCC commanded on. Using scan tool, monitor TCC slip speed. If TCC slip speed is 80-800 RPM for 7 seconds, go to next step. If TCC slip speed is not 80-800 RPM for 7 seconds, see DIAGNOSTIC AIDS .
  4. Check TCC solenoid valve for internal malfunction or damaged seals. Repair as necessary. After repairs, go to step  14. If TCC solenoid valve is okay, go to next step.
  5. Check all shift solenoid valves for internal malfunctions or damaged seals. Repair as necessary. After repairs, go to step  14. If shift solenoids are okay, go to next step.
  6. Check valve body for stuck regulator apply valve or scored regulator apply valve body. Repair as necessary. After repairs, go to step  13. If no problem is found, go to next step.
  7. Check torque converter for worn stator shaft bushing, defective stator roller clutch or external damage and leaks. Repair as necessary. After repairs, go to step  13. If torque converter is okay, go to next step.
  8. Check oil pump assembly for stuck, mispositioned or incorrectly installed valves and springs. Check for mispositioned oil pump gasket, restricted or damaged orifice cup plugs. Check for overtightened or unevenly tightened pump body-to-cover bolts. Repair as necessary. After repairs, go to step  13. If no problem is found, go to next step.
  9. Check input housing and shaft assembly for restricted or damaged turbine shaft retainer and ball assembly. Check for cut or damaged turbine shaft "O" ring seal. Repair as necessary. After repairs, go to step  13. If no problem is found, go to next step.
  10. Check condition of 2-4 band components (i.e., pistons, seals, band, oil passages, case piston bore, etc.). Repair as necessary. After repairs, go to step  13. If no problem is found, go to next step.
  11. Check condition of forward clutch components (i.e., clutch plates, piston, seals, retainer and ball, etc.). Repair as necessary. After repairs, go to step  13. If no problem is found, go to next step.
  12. Check condition of 3-4 clutch components (i.e., clutch plates, piston, seals, orifice cup plug, etc.). Repair as necessary. After repairs, go to next step. If no problem is found, see DIAGNOSTIC AIDS .
  13. Change transmission fluid. See appropriate AUTOMATIC article in TRANSMISSION SERVICING. Using scan tool, clear TAPS function. After repairs, go to next step.
  14. Using scan tool, clear DTCs. Test drive vehicle in "D4" range with TCC on and TP sensor angle at 20-99 percent. Ensure TCC slip speed -20 to 60 RPM for at least 7 seconds. Check for DTCs. If DTC P1870 does not return, system is okay. If DTC P1870 returns, go to step  1.
